What is the median home price in Chicago Heights School District 170?

The median home value in Chicago Heights School District 170 is $147k. The median monthly rent is $1,035. Annual property taxes average $4k. Home values are based on U.S. Census Bureau American Community Survey estimates.

Are home values rising in Chicago Heights School District 170?

Home values in Chicago Heights School District 170 have increased 20.9% over the past two years. This indicates a strong appreciation trend. This data is sourced from the Federal Housing Finance Agency (FHFA) House Price Index.

How much income do you need to buy a home in Chicago Heights School District 170?

Based on a typical all-in ownership cost of $1,045/month (mortgage, taxes, insurance), you'd generally need a household income of approximately $45k/year to keep housing costs at or below 28% of gross income — a common lender guideline. The median household income in Chicago Heights School District 170 is $57k/year.
